Kinder Bueno Cheesecake Truffles

INGREDIENTS
- 60g lightest Philadelphia cream cheese
- 200g Kinder Bueno milk chocolate and hazelnut bars (as seen in photo)
- 100g milk chocolate
METHOD
- Using a large knife chop up the Kinder bars as small as you can (this step takes a few minutes!)
- Mix this together with the cream cheese.
- Roll this mixture into 18 small balls.
- Place onto parchment paper and put in fridge for 30 mins to firm up.
- Melt the chocolate and coat each ball evenly.
- Place back onto parchment paper and into fridge for an hour to set and ENJOY!
TIPS
- For an even healthier version of these, swap out the cream cheese for fat free quark.
- You can make the truffles as big or as small as you like. Just beware - the bigger the truffle the more calories, but who cares when it's this good!
- I also drizzle a little white chocolate over the top for extra decoration.
